What Is a Second?

A second is the SI Base Unit of time defined by the International System of Units (SI) and maintained by the International Bureau of Weights and Measures (BIPM). It measures duration, time intervals, and elapsed time in science, engineering, computing, astronomy, and everyday life.

What Is a Year?

A year is the time required for Earth to complete one orbit around the Sun. Depending on the application, it may refer to a Common Year, Leap Year, Gregorian Calendar year, or Julian Year. Choosing the correct year standard improves conversion accuracy for time measurement and chronological calculations.

Seconds to Years Conversion Formula

Using a common 365-day year:

Years=Seconds31,536,000 \text{Years}=\frac{\text{Seconds}}{31,536,000}

Where:

  • 11 Year =365=365 Days
  • 11 Day =24=24 Hours
  • 11 Hour =60=60 Minutes
  • 11 Minute =60=60 Seconds

Therefore:

1 Year=365×24×60×60=31,536,000 Seconds 1\ \text{Year}=365 \times 24 \times 60 \times 60=31,536,000\ \text{Seconds}

For an average Gregorian year that includes leap years:

Years=Seconds31,557,600 \text{Years}=\frac{\text{Seconds}}{31,557,600}

Practical Example of Seconds to Years Conversion

Suppose you want to convert 63,072,000 seconds into years using a common 365-day year.

Given:

Seconds=63,072,000 \text{Seconds}=63,072,000

Apply the formula:

Years=63,072,00031,536,000=2 \text{Years}=\frac{63,072,000}{31,536,000}=2

Result:

63,072,000 Seconds=2 Years 63,072,000\ \text{Seconds}=2\ \text{Years}

Common Seconds to Years Conversion Mistakes

Many conversion errors occur because users apply the wrong year length, confuse a Common Year with a Leap Year or Julian Year, or round values too early. Always use the appropriate Conversion Formula, verify the calendar standard, and maintain sufficient precision for scientific, engineering, and time measurement calculations.
